guinea_worm | ||
1. | [ noun ] a painful and debilitating infestation contracted by drinking stagnant water contaminated with Guinea worm larvae that can mature inside a human's abdomen until the worm emerges through a painful blister in the person's skin | |
Synonyms: | guinea_worm_disease dracunculiasis | |
Related terms: | infestation | |
2. | [ noun ] (zoology) parasitic roundworm of India and Africa that lives in the abdomen or beneath the skin of humans and other vertebrates | |
Synonyms: | Dracunculus_medinensis | |
